How to Choose a Cheap and High-Quality Kitchen Sink
The most affordable sinks today are stainless steel as well as pushed steel. The reduced cost stainless as well as journalism steel are likewise known as "apartment or condo" quality. They call them this since home proprietors, trying to find the most affordable prices tend to use these products. If you get on a budget and your family members are not hefty customers of the cooking area sink, these might be an attractive option to more pricey products. Be aware though that the pressed steel sink generally has a painted surface area that damages and chips quickly. These sinks will have a tendency to look old and outdated rapidly because of the finish utilized. The stainless likewise scrapes easily however if looked after correctly, it will certainly remain to look appropriate. Cheaper stainless steel sinks tend to be constructed from thinner product which means that water being ran into them as well as the garbage disposal will certainly seem a whole lot louder on these more economical models. These sinks can be found in rimless as well as leading mounted versions.

A guaranteed upgrade to these items is the actors iron cooking area sink. These sinks are made of casted steel them finished with a porcelain material providing a deep and also gorgeous radiance. The coating is long putting on and also with a little occasional waxing, can look great for years. They are available in a selection of shades and can be ordered in undercounter mounting or top installing styles. These cooking area sinks however are heavy and far more hard to mount so unless you are exceptionally convenient and have experience with these sinks, you will require a specialist for installment.

One more sink material that seems to be acquiring in appeal is the solid surface area kind material These are a durable material formed into a cooking area sink as well as have a tendency to be more of a matte surface. This sort of sink product goes particularly well with even more all-natural finishes in your kitchen area. Although not as popular as cast-iron, these composite cooking area sinks are rapidly obtaining a solid following.

HOW DO YOU CHOOSE THE BEST UNDERMOUNT KITCHEN SINK?


Consider your sink's dimension


The size of your sink is something you must consider. If you have a smaller kitchen, you may want a smaller sink. However, if your kitchen is spacious, a larger sink is a better choice. The depth and width of your sink will also matter when determining which one is best for your home.


Decide on the right material


Undermount kitchen sinks are typically made from stainless steel, copper, or cast iron. Stainless steel is a popular choice because it is durable and easy to clean. Copper sinks can be expensive, but they are attractive and give your kitchen a classic look. Cast iron sinks are usually cheaper than copper, but they have a shorter lifespan and require more maintenance.


Determine the number of bowls you need


The choice between single bowl, double bowl, or triple bowl sinks is a matter of personal preference, but there are some other factors that might influence your decision. If you have limited counter space, you might want to consider a single-bowl sink in order to maximize your work area. However, if you have ample space or want to do large dishes then it's ideal to go for double or triple bowl sinks.
